What is a geologist?

Geologists are scientists who study the Earth, its composition, structure, processes, and history. They analyze rocks, minerals, and fossils to understand how the planet has changed over time and to predict future geological events. Geologists work in a variety of industries, including environmental consulting, oil and gas, mining, and academia. Their work is crucial for resource management, environmental protection, and assessing natural hazards like earthquakes and landslides.

What are some common challenges a geotechnical engineer may face when working on construction projects?

Geotechnical Engineers often encounter challenges such as varying soil conditions, unexpected groundwater levels, and the need to interpret complex site data. These factors can impact the design and safety of foundations, slopes, and retaining structures. Effective communication with civil engineers, contractors, and environmental specialists is essential to address these issues promptly and ensure project timelines and safety standards are maintained.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a geologist,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Geologist, you need a solid background in earth sciences, geology, and fieldwork, typically supported by a relevant degree in geology or earth science. Familiarity with GIS software, rock and mineral analysis tools, and sometimes certifications like a Professional Geologist (PG) license are commonly required. Strong analytical thinking, attention to detail, and effective communication skills help geologists excel in both independent and collaborative environments. These skills are essential for accurately interpreting geological data, ensuring safety, and making informed decisions in resource exploration or environmental projects.
